Manchester United boss Jose Mourinho has admitted that he is still interested in signing Real Madrid star Gareth Bale.
The Welsh star has been tipped to make a stunning move away from Santiago Bernabeu this summer with reports that the club’s hierarchy wants to offload the winger after getting wary of his poor injury record.
Mourinho has now revealed plans to lure Bale to Old Trafford if he does not start their clash against Real Madrid in the Super Cup Final in Macedonia.

‘Well if he’s playing tomorrow, no I wouldn’t think of that, it would be because he’s in the coach’s plans and the club’s plans, because he also has that motivation to continue at Real Madrid,’ he said.
‘So I haven’t even thought about the possibility.
‘If he is not in the club’s plans, that with the arrival of another player would mean he was on his way out, I will try to be waiting for him on the other side and fight with other coaches that would want him on their team.
‘But if he plays tomorrow, that is the best confirmation that he is still wanted by the team.’
